Transaction 7a2b9eea1dd1b7528b79b6e91edd3e9c2e0ae4f832416a08f410afadbcfa33e3

29 Input
1 Outputs
  • 7a2b9eea1dd1b7528b79b6e91edd3e9c2e0ae4f832416a08f410afadbcfa33e3:0
  • value  29308759
    address  1GG877ZvXgWQm4GvjoMcRTPWEYPZzGk7JR